The Cisco IOS software image is a stable, maintenance-focused release for the Cisco 1900 Series Integrated Services Routers (ISR) . While newer versions exist, this specific M7 build is often considered "better" for legacy environments because it prioritizes long-term stability and security fixes over new, potentially unstable features.
